Plano pool plans summer wrap-up

Plano will be celebrating Labor Day by making a splash at one of its pools, and this will conclude summer with an afternoon of active excitement.

The Texas Pool will celebrate fall’s arrival by supplying many ways to get wet, and there will be special activities on offer. General admission tickets are $10, and the fun will keep going for six hours.

During the Labor Day Party, bathers will be invited to play a variety of traditional pool games, and the cannonball contest will provide a chance to win a prize. The snack bar will be open, and everyone can utilize the barbecue grills and enjoy their food in the picnic area. Coolers will be welcome, but all beverages brought must be non-alcoholic. Plano will be giving summer one last hurrah with its Labor Day Party set to make a splash on Monday, September 7. The activity will begin at 2:00 pm, and the agenda runs until 8:00 pm.
